Tennis Consistency Training: The Science of Repeating vs. Variant

Uniformity is just one of one of the most important qualities in tennis. Players that can consistently implement reputable shots frequently exceed opponents with greater power yet reduced precision. Attaining uniformity calls for reliable training approaches, and one of the most debated subjects in sporting activities scientific research is whether repeating or variation generates much better outcomes.

Typical tennis training often stresses repetition. Players struck thousands of forehands, backhands, and volleys to strengthen muscular tissue memory. This method is beneficial since it helps develop technical proficiency and confidence. Repeated direct exposure to the exact same motion enables the mind and body to collaborate more successfully.

Nevertheless, tennis suits rarely include the same circumstances. Every point presents unique difficulties entailing various sphere rates, spins, trajectories, and court positions. This is where variant ends up being essential.

Training systems such as the Tenniix Basic and Tenniix Ultra supply an excellent balance in between rep and variation. Gamers can repeat basic shots enough to create dependability while presenting changing conditions that far better reflect real-match settings.

The Tenniix Basic allows customers to tailor sphere rate, spin, frequency, and placement. This versatility allows gamers to execute regulated recurring technique prior to proceeding to a lot more varied drills. By gradually enhancing complexity, professional athletes create both technical uniformity and flexibility.

The Tenniix Ultra takes this idea better with AI-enhanced training settings. The machine can create vibrant drill patterns that challenge players to readjust constantly. Instead of understanding specifically where the following round will certainly land, professional athletes should react and adapt just as they would throughout competition.

Sports science research study suggests that variable practice frequently improves ability retention and transfer to affordable situations. When gamers come across varied training scenarios, they learn to solve problems instead of simply remember activities. Consistency training ought to as a result not concentrate only on duplicating ideal shots. Real consistency indicates performing properly under transforming scenarios. Players have to find out to keep strategy, timing, and decision-making regardless of the scenario.

A balanced training program combines both approaches. Repeating develops the technological foundation, while variation creates adaptability and strength. AI-powered equipments make it less complicated than ever before to integrate both components right into day-to-day method.

For players seeking lasting improvement, the objective needs to not be to select between repeating and variant. Instead, they should utilize innovation to mix these training concepts in a way that optimizes efficiency and prepares them genuine affordable obstacles.
